CNC Programmer/Machinist/Setup
Listed on 2026-03-12
-
Manufacturing / Production
CNC Machinist, Machine Operator, Manufacturing Production
BMC Metalworks, LLC is a full-service machine, fabrication services company located in Columbia, Tennessee. Spanning over a 7 acre campus and 75,000 square foot of buildings. We are a 52 year old family owned business with competitive wages and benefits including:
Medical, Dental, Vision, Short Term Disability, Life Insurance, Vacation Accrual, Paid Holidays, 401K and profit sharing.
Be a CNC Programmer, Machinist, Setup & Operator in the Machine job shop in our newer 3,000 square foot state-of-the-art CNC precision and high volume machining center!
Job DescriptionAs a CNC Programmer Machinist, you will be responsible for setting up, operating, and maintaining computer numerical control (CNC) machines to produce high-quality precision parts.
Sets-ups mills and lathes by installing and adjusting three- and four-jaw chucks, tools, attachments, collets, bushings, cams, gears, stops, and stock pushers; indicating vices; tramming heads
Qualifications- 3-5 years (required) experience of CNC programming (using software such as Surfcam & Mastercam), Setup, and Operation with the ability to interpret engineering illustrations, blueprint components, work with CNC equipment including HAAS VF8, VF3, VF-3YT, VM-3, CNC & Conventional Lathes and Fourth Axis machines, and possess job shop environment experience.
- CNC programming machinist knowledge & experience
- Maintain a clean and organized work area
- Utmost attention to safety
- Reliable, good attendance and punctuality
- Candidate will be working with CAD, CAM and software programs utilizing intermediate to advanced knowledge while training towards full working knowledge
- Position will be responsible for machining mechanical parts, pieces or products to customer drawings and specifications using a variety of tools and high-tech milling and drilling equipment
- Plans machining by studying work orders, blueprints, engineering plans, materials, specifications, orthographic drawings, reference planes, locations of surfaces, and machining parameters; interpreting geometric dimensions and tolerances (GD&T)
- Daily activities will include programming one off parts, small to medium run, in either Surfcam or Mastercam.
- Setting up your HAAS milling and lathe machines
- Operate calipers, inspection gauges, micrometers, and other quality control instrumentation
- Maintain CNC mill and other machines using preventative maintenance methods
- Continually evaluate machine, cutting tool, and software technologies to improve knowledge and cycle times
- Maintain inventory of manufacturing product and machine tools
- Maintains specifications by observing drilling, grooving, and cutting, including turning, facing, knurling and thread chasing operations; taking measurements; detecting malfunctions; troubleshooting processes; adjusting and reprogramming controls; sharpening and replacing worn tools; adhering to quality assurance procedures and processes
- Create specific machine set-ups and fixturing to meet geometric requirements
- Perform quality work checks to ensure the product meets quality standards
- Work with quality control department to Identify product defects and complete appropriate documentation when defects are identified
- Rework and/or repair machined parts and products according to engineering specification changes and revisions
- Perform all work in accordance with quality standards and established safety procedures
- Prioritize work flow through effective communication with management staff
Full-Time
Day Shift1st Day Shift (5 days/8 hours)
Night Shift2nd Night Shift (4 days/10 hours)
Overtime opportunities available
Hourly rate commensurate with skills, abilities, and experience
Benefits for Full-Time BMC Metalworks Employees- Supplemental Insurance :
Short Term Disability, Critical Illness, Accident, Life Insurance
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).